AI Summary
-
Expands pharmacist scope of practice to administer influenza vaccines to persons 10+ years old and other vaccines to 18+ year-olds under written protocol with physicians, physician assistants, or advanced practice nurses; requires training and reporting to patient's primary provider or immunization registry.
-
Creates comprehensive disciplinary framework for Board of Pharmacy including grounds for action, forms of discipline (denial, suspension, revocation, civil penalties up to $10,000), and procedures for cease and desist orders with expedited hearings.
-
Clarifies drug compounding requirements and exemptions; permits outsourcing facilities registered with FDA to be licensed by the board; prohibits compounding of drugs on federal unsafe list and commercially available drug copies.
-
Allows accredited postsecondary schools to possess non-controlled legend drugs for health care education programs and permits certain entities to handle drugs for emergency use authorizations.
-
Adds acetyl fentanyl, alpha-PVP, 4-Me-PHP, AB-PINACA, and AB-FUBINACA to Schedule I controlled substances; broadens definition of "drug" to include unapproved substances that mimic Schedule I or II effects regardless of marketing purpose.
Legislative Description
Health definitions modified and added, immunization requirement pharmacist participation changed; Board of Pharmacy powers and duties, and business regulation licensing requirements changed; compounding requirements clarified, legend drug purchase allowed by educational institutions, entities allowed to handle drugs in preparation for emergency use, drug manufacturers payment reporting clarified, and substances added to the controlled substances schedules.
